Education
In 2013, there were 218 programs for physiotherapists accredited by the Commission on Accreditation in Physical Therapy Education, all which provided a Doctor of Physical Therapy (DPT) degree.
DPT programs generally last 3 years. The majority of programs require a bachelor's degree for admission along with particular prerequisites, such as anatomy, physiology, biology, chemistry, and physics. The majority of DPT programs require candidates to use with the Physical Specialist Centralized Application Service (PTCAS).
Physical specialist programs typically include courses in biomechanics, anatomy, physiology, neuroscience, and pharmacology. Physical specialist students also full medical internships, throughout which they obtain monitored experience in areas such as intense care and orthopedic care.
Physical therapists may use to and finish a scientific residency program after college graduation. Residencies normally last about 1 year and provide additional training and experience in specialized locations of care. Therapists who have completed a residency program may decide to specialize further by completing a fellowship in a sophisticated professional area.
Licenses, Certifications, and Registrations
All Indianas need physiotherapists to be certified. Licensing requirements vary by Indiana however all include passing the National Physical Therapy Assessment administered by the Federation of Indiana Boards of Physical Therapy. A number of Indianas likewise need a law test and a criminal background check. Continuing education is typically needed for physiotherapists to keep their license. Contact Indiana boards for certain licensing demands.
After gaining work experience, some physical therapists decide to end up being a board-certified specialist. The American Board of Physical Therapy Specialties offers accreditation in 8 clinical specialty areas, including orthopedics and geriatric physical therapy. Board professional accreditation needs passing an examination and a minimum of 2,000 hours of medical work or conclusion of an APTA-accredited residency program in the specialized area.
Important Qualities
Compassion. Physiotherapists are commonly drawn to the profession in part by a desire to assist people. They work with people who are in discomfort and needs to have empathy for their clients.
Information oriented. Like other health care providers, physiotherapists must have strong analytic and observational abilities to detect a patients trouble, evaluate treatments, and supply safe, reliable care.
Dexterity. Physiotherapists need to use their hands to offer manual therapy and restorative workouts. They must feel comfy massaging and otherwise physically helping clients.
Interpersonal skills. Due to the fact that physiotherapists invest a great deal of time communicating with patients, they must enjoy working with people. They have to be able to explain treatment programs, motivate patients, and listen to clients concerns to supply efficient therapy.
Physical stamina. Physiotherapists invest much of their time on their feet, moving as they deal with patients. They need to enjoy exercising.
Resourcefulness. Physiotherapists personalize therapy strategies for clients. They must be flexible and able to adapt plans of care to fulfill the requirements of each patient.
